Reeve and Ayleth Slyder were born the same. One, just as mischievous as the other. Always together, never apart, but certainly not where they needed to be. The trouble they got in together, and all the problems they caused all led up to one event in their lives that changed everything. And it was on that fateful day that the twins truly lost who they were.

​

Centuries ago, the biggest battle in the history of Asucaeca sent the island country of Alevia spiralling into danger, forcing everyone to hide behind the walls of their own cities to protect themselves from the mystery of what lay beyond. The years passed on and wore their agony on the Slyders, tragedy after tragedy striking their home with no means of an end. After vision-turned nightmares and a happy evening gone horribly wrong, Ayleth and Reeve are forced to make a decision to fight for what they believe in, both with their own mysteries to solve. The only problem is that they need to go beyond the wall, and no one knows what’s out there. Going into unknown territory unprepared after five centuries of silence is the last thing they want to do, especially if they’re to separate. Unfortunately, they have no choice.

​

Encountering companions along the way with interesting histories of their own, the Slyder twins must work quickly to uncover the truth of their secret past in order to find out who is responsible for all the destruction and pain left in their wake. But a terrible danger lies ahead of them both, and the future can’t always be changed.
